Tuao

Tuao, officially the Municipality of Tuao, is a municipality in the province of Cagayan, Philippines. According to the 2024 census, it has a population of 66,147 people.

Climate in Tuao

Tuao has an average annual temperature of 27.1°C (81°F). The hottest month is Jun (29.8°C), the coldest is Jan (23.4°C). Average annual precipitation is 1804 mm.

Month Avg °C / °F Min / Max °C Rain (mm)
Jan 23.4°C / 74°F 18.6° / 28.1° 34.8
Feb 24.6°C / 76°F 19° / 30.2° 37.2
Mar 26.8°C / 80°F 20.9° / 32.7° 38.5
Apr 29°C / 84°F 22.8° / 35.1° 46.8
May 29.6°C / 85°F 23.5° / 35.6° 134.9
Jun 29.8°C / 86°F 24.2° / 35.4° 152.5
Jul 28.8°C / 84°F 23.7° / 33.9° 197.6
Aug 28.4°C / 83°F 23.4° / 33.3° 227.9
Sep 28.1°C / 83°F 23.2° / 33° 232.7
Oct 26.6°C / 80°F 22° / 31.3° 269.8
Nov 25.7°C / 78°F 21.4° / 30° 269.9
Dec 23.9°C / 75°F 20° / 27.8° 160.9

Tsunami History

4 tsunamis recorded within 500 km. Highest wave on record: 1.0 m (3 ft).

Year Location Cause Max Wave Deaths Distance
1988 NORTH OF LUZON ISLAND Earthquake 1.0 m 107 km
2022 N. LUZON ISLAND Earthquake 0.1 m 11 72 km
1983 LUZON ISLAND Earthquake 16 84 km
1627 W. LUZON ISLAND Earthquake 113 km
Source: NOAA/NCEI Historical Tsunami Database. Sorted by wave height.

Nearby Volcanoes

3 volcanoes within 200 km. Closest: Ambalatungan Group (60 km).

Name Type Elevation Last Eruption Distance
Ambalatungan Group Compound 2,329 m (7,641 ft) Unknown 60 km
Cagua Stratovolcano 1,133 m (3,717 ft) 1860 89 km
Camiguin de Babuyanes Stratovolcano 712 m (2,336 ft) 1857 129 km
Source: Smithsonian Institution Global Volcanism Program (GVP). Sorted by distance.
